UPS shares advanced 1.15% to $102.18, reflecting a measured uptick that aligned with a broader recovery in industrial and transportation sectors. Trading volume appeared in line with recent averages, suggesting the move was driven by routine portfolio rebalancing rather than a catalyst-driven surge. The logistics industry has faced headwinds from moderating e-commerce volumes and ongoing labor cost pressures, yet UPS has maintained its status as a bellwether for package delivery demand. Investors are closely monitoring parcel yield management and cost-control initiatives that could underpin margin stabilization. The company’s broad economic exposure means its stock often correlates with gross domestic product and consumer spending expectations. Friday’s price action may also reflect positioning ahead of upcoming macroeconomic data releases, including retail sales and manufacturing indexes, which historically influence transportation equities. Without a specific company announcement, the 1.15% advance appears to stem from a combination of technical factors and general market optimism rather than a fundamental shift in outlook. The stock’s recent price action shows a series of higher lows, suggesting building upward momentum. However, the $102–$103 zone has acted as a short-term pivot area, and Friday’s close just above $102 indicates buyers remain in control but without breakout conviction. Momentum indicators such as the relative strength index (RSI) appear to be in the neutral-to-slightly-bullish range — likely in the low-to-mid 50s — implying room for further gains before entering overbought territory. Moving averages may show the stock trading near or slightly above its 50-day moving average while remaining below a downward-sloping 200-day moving average, reflecting a longer-term bearish bias that has yet to reverse. Volume patterns remain steady, without signs of accumulation or distribution extremes. The $97.07 support level is critical; a breach could signal a retest of recent lows. Conversely, sustained buying above $104 would be needed to challenge the $107.29 resistance. If the stock can break above $104 and hold, it could set up a test of the $107.29 resistance zone, a level that has contained rallies since the stock’s decline from earlier highs. A decisive move above that resistance might signal a trend reversal, potentially opening the door to the $112–$115 area. Conversely, failure to hold above $100 could lead to a retest of the $97.07 support. Continued weakness in global trade volumes or rising fuel costs could act as headwinds, while better-than-expected peak-season delivery data or cost-cutting announcements may provide positive catalysts. Investors should monitor the company’s next earnings report for guidance on revenue trends and margin expectations. The stock may also be sensitive to broader market risk sentiment and Federal Reserve policy signals. Any macro shock or sector rotation could alter the current equilibrium. Overall, UPS appears at a crossroads, with near-term price direction likely determined by its ability to either build on the current rally or succumb to resistance.
